Understanding Flange Alignment Tools

Flange Alignment Tools are devices designed to align flanges accurately when installing pipes, valves, and other components in industrial settings. Flanges, typically circular discs with evenly spaced holes for bolts, are used to connect two pipes or other equipment. The alignment of these flanges is critical to prevent leaks, reduce stress on components, and ensure the system’s overall integrity.

Key Features of Flange Alignment Tools

These tools boast various features that make them indispensable in industrial applications. Most Flange Alignment Tools are equipped with adjustable arms, ensuring flexibility to accommodate different flange sizes. The arms are designed to fit into the bolt holes of the flanges, providing a stable reference point for alignment.

Some advanced Flange Alignment Tools incorporate magnets or other securing mechanisms, allowing them to stay in place during the alignment process. This feature is precious when manual tool holding may be challenging or unsafe.

A compact and ergonomic form is another feature that makes many Flange Alignment Tools easy to handle and manoeuvre in confined locations. This is crucial in industrial environments where accessibility can be limited, and precision is non-negotiable.

The Importance of Flange Alignment

Accurate flange alignment is a critical step in installing and maintaining piping systems. Poorly aligned flanges can result in a myriad of issues, including leaks, increased stress on equipment, and reduced operational efficiency. Flange misalignment can lead to uneven loading on bolts, causing premature wear and compromising the structural integrity of the entire system.

Furthermore, in industries where the transportation of fluids or gases is involved, any misalignment can result in leaks, posing safety hazards to personnel and potentially causing environmental damage. Benefits of Flange Alignment Tools

Enhanced Efficiency: Flange Alignment Tools streamline the installation process, reducing the time and effort required for precise alignment. This contributes to increased overall efficiency in project timelines.

Cost Savings: By preventing leaks and reducing wear on components, Flange Alignment Tools contribute to cost savings in maintenance and repairs. The upfront investment in these tools is a wise decision in the long run.

Improved Safety: Preventing leaks and lowering the risk of accidents and injuries related to system malfunctions are achieved by precise flange alignment. Keeping a safe working environment depends on using flange alignment tools.

Longevity of Equipment: Properly aligned flanges distribute loads evenly, reducing stress on bolts and equipment. This, in turn, enhances the lifespan of industrial assets and minimizes the need for frequent replacements.
